News summary

The first phase of the ceasefire between Israel and Hamas officially ended, with ongoing negotiations in Cairo for a second phase that would aim for a more permanent resolution. While Hamas is prepared to continue with the next steps of the ceasefire, they have rejected Israel's proposal to extend the initial phase, which would primarily focus on prisoner exchanges rather than long-term solutions. Israeli Prime Minister Netanyahu's team returned from negotiations in Cairo without a definitive outcome, as the situation remains tense with both sides holding firm on their positions. Meanwhile, the humanitarian crisis in Gaza worsens as displaced persons face dire conditions during Ramadan, with heavy rains flooding makeshift shelters and a lack of resources exacerbating their suffering. Observers note a contrast in Ramadan celebrations this year compared to previous years, with some residents returning to damaged homes but still feeling the impacts of conflict. The situation remains precarious, with talks expected to continue as both parties seek to navigate the complexities of the ceasefire agreement.
